Satoshi Layer, a new zero-knowledge TVM rollup designed to supercharge the TON network. By blending cutting-edge cryptographic innovations with a specialized focus on on-chain gaming, Satoshi Layer is designed to push the boundaries of what blockchain can do, especially for the gaming community.

For instance, Satoshi Layer uses a clever mix of zero-knowledge proofs and Federated Byzantine Agreement to keep things both secure and super-efficient. In simpler terms, it takes all those complex transactions happening every second and bundles them into neat, verifiable proofs. As a result, this system that can potentially crank out up to 90,000 transactions per second. For someone who’s ever experienced slow load times or lag in an online game, this is a total game changer.

But it’s not all about numbers and tech specs. Satoshi Layer has a clear heart—it’s deeply committed to the world of GameFi. With a focus on multiplayer games, open-world adventures, and sandbox creativity, Satoshi Layer is building the kind of on-chain playground that developers and gamers alike have been dreaming about. It’s about creating an environment where every in-game move is both instant and transparent, giving players more control and trust over their digital assets and experiences.

The tech behind it is as fascinating as it is smart. Satoshi Layer’s architecture relies on a layered approach, using components like bridge contracts, execution nodes, and zkTVM provers. These parts all work together, ensuring that data isn’t just stored securely, but also made available exactly when and where it’s needed. This means a seamless, low-latency experience—an essential feature for dynamic online games where every millisecond counts.

What truly sets Satoshi Layer apart is its commitment to community ownership. With the Satoshi Game DAO at the helm, decisions get made by the people, for the people. Holders of the SAT token have a say in every critical change and upgrade, ensuring that the platform evolves in a way that benefits everyone involved. This decentralized approach isn’t just a buzzword—it’s a promise to keep the network transparent and truly accountable.

Looking ahead, the roadmap for Satoshi Layer looks both ambitious and exciting to me. The project is set to roll out in phases: starting with a proof of concept and Devnet launch in Q2 2025, moving into network layer development in Q3 2025, followed by a testnet and SDK release in Q4 2025. And by Q1 2026, the ecosystem will blossom further with the launch of decentralized exchanges, bridges, and explorers. It’s a steady, thoughtful build-up aimed at ensuring every piece of the puzzle fits together perfectly before the next big step.
